Burgundy Diamond Mines Ltd
Burgundy Diamond Mines Limited, a resources company, focuses on the mining, production, cutting, polishing, grading, and sale of diamonds. It operates through Rough Diamond and Polished segments. The Rough Diamond segment engages in the mining, sale, and marketing of rough diamonds. Its Polished Diamond segment engages in the manufacture, sale, and marketing of polished diamonds. Annual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ency for Burgundy Diamond Mines Ltd (2013–2025)
The table below shows the annual cash flow conversion efficiency of Burgundy Diamond Mines Ltd from 2013 to 2025.
| Year | Net Assets | Operating Cash Flow |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025-06-30 | AU$100.24 Million | AU$87.08 Million | 0.869x | +96.76% |
| 2024-06-30 | AU$231.89 Million | AU$102.37 Million | 0.441x | +529.89% |
| 2023-06-30 | AU$165.87 Million | AU$-17.03 Million | -0.103x | +97.86% |
| 2022-06-30 | AU$5.32 Million | AU$-25.59 Million | -4.807x | +32.29% |
| 2021-06-30 | AU$1.43 Million | AU$-10.12 Million | -7.100x | -1819.99% |
| 2020-06-30 | AU$4.20 Million | AU$-1.55 Million | -0.370x | +30.38% |
| 2019-06-30 | AU$2.46 Million | AU$-1.31 Million | -0.531x | +53.69% |
| 2018-06-30 | AU$3.75 Million | AU$-4.30 Million | -1.147x | -569.17% |
| 2017-06-30 | AU$4.44 Million | AU$-761.79K | -0.171x | +34.99% |
| 2016-06-30 | AU$5.88 Million | AU$-1.55 Million | -0.264x | +35.84% |
| 2015-06-30 | AU$4.10 Million | AU$-1.68 Million | -0.411x | -91.49% |
| 2014-06-30 | AU$4.96 Million | AU$-1.07 Million | -0.215x | -125.08% |
| 2013-06-30 | AU$5.03 Million | AU$-479.90K | -0.095x | -- |
